Arcadia Performing Arts Center Announces Spectacular New Season The Arcadia Performing Arts Center announces today its new 2018-19 Season 7. Presented by the Arcadia Performing Arts Foundation, the new season features legacy artists and emerging talent, reflects a diverse community, and raises funds to give back to local schools. An all-inclusive membership program encourages community, highlights leadership, and honors legacy members. KFI AM 640 is the season's official radio partner.

Season 7 opens on Saturday, September 22nd, 2018 with the Star Party Gala featuring Grammy Award-winner and 9-time Billboard jazz charts icon Steve Tyrell. The Gala honors philanthropists Alan and Sandy Whitman. The season's broad range of cultural and educational programming includes Legacy, International, Classical, Family, Dance, Theatre, and the Black Box Series.

The Center is the busiest premiere cultural destination venue in Pasadena and San Gabriel Valley. The venue features a state-of-the-art concert hall, black box theatre, and outdoor festival courtyard.

The Foundation is the nonprofit fundraising organization that supports the Center. Last season, the Foundation launched Arcadia's first Classical Series, STEAM festival, Americana festival, Lunar New Year festival, Arcadia's first professional theatre company, and an job training program.

About the Arcadia Performing Arts Foundation

The Arcadia Performing Arts Foundation is a non-profit community transformation organization that supports the Arcadia Performing Arts Center, arts education in the schools, and arts excellence in Pasadena and San Gabriel Valley. The busiest venue in the region with 256 days in production last year, the state-of-the-art venue features a 1,163-seat main hall, 125-seat black box theatre, outdoor courtyard for festivals, and rehearsal spaces for college preparatory classes in dance, music, and theatre.

Located adjacent to Arcadia High School, the venue is a daily classroom for 1,300 students every year. Former arts students include Stevie Nicks, Van Halen's Michael Anthony Sobolewski, NFL Hall of Famer and marching band member Bruce Matthews, and Emmy Award-winning producer of NBC's The Voice Barton Kimball.

Cultural programming featuring world-class artists such as Paul Anka, Herb Alpert, Four Tops, Steve Tyrell, and Vicki Lawrence have engaged the community, raised funds for education, and provided opportunities for students to build a professional portfolio. The foundation's educational programs include California Children's Choir, Black Box Series, ArtWORK job training program, and annual Arts Excellence Prize.
